Abstract

The article points to the limitations of two traditions within political liberalism regarding the question of distributive justice in the context of Latín America. The author shows the necessity of restating the concept of justice, in order to obtain a more adequate normative basis for the evaluation and criticism of the particular forms of distribution of social possessions existing at present.
